Introduction:
Biomolecules consist oforganic (abundant) and inorganic molecules are found in the body of organisms. Organic molecules are made up of elements, such as carbon, hydrogen, oxygen, sulfur, nitroge, nnd phosphorus. The variety of these organic biomolecules is due to the fact that carbon has a valency of four and can form strong covalent bonds with carbon or any other atom.
